Lake Grapevine Fishing Guide Report - 6/8/11

James brought his dad and buddy Rick out to Grapevine for a full-day instructional catfishing trip. We started off the morning fishing some shallow water patterns for blue cats picking up a few at each set up along with several sandbass and a drum. About 11:00 we changed tactics and broke out the channel cat rods for some non-stop catching. At one point I couldn't keep 3 rods baited and in the water before someone pulled in another fish or missed one needing more bait. After a couple of hours of channel catfishing we rigged up for some more blue cat action. We then did a little drft fishing to wrap up the trip. The winds were up a a bit, but we were still able to catch several more nice fish. We used fresh shad with Dead Red Blood Spray to catch all of the blues and a few of the channel cats. The rest of the channel cats were caught on Sudden Impact and Secret 7 from Team Catfish. The fish did show a big preferrence for the Secret 7 this time. Totals for the day were 42 catfish, 3 sandbass and a small drum. They also released quite a few undersized channel cats. Always a pleasure sharing the boat with great folks and great anglers. Lake Lewisville Fishing Guide Report - 6/10/11

Phil and Suzanne joined me for a half-day channel cat trip on Lake Lewisville. I barely had a chance to get two rods in the water before the fish started coming in the boat. The first 20 minutes were fast and furious with several doubles and even a triple! Then the bite just died. We made several moves picking up a few fish at each stop. The last spot proved to be the one we were looking for. They finished up their 50 fish limit of channel cats and one blue in just under 5 hours. Suzanne lost a really nice blue that would have pushed the 10 lb mark. The #6 trebble hook just didn't find anything solid and managed to pull loose about 10 feet from the boat. All fish were caught on Secret 7 Dip Bait and Sudden Impact from Team Catfish using Carolina rigs. The magic depth was 1-10 feet deep. Here are a couple of photos from Friday's trip.

Lake Lewisville Catfishing Report - 6/11/11

I had repeat customers, Eddie and his wife Marcy in the boat with me this morning. We mixed things up a bit and did a half-day instructional trip looking for both blues and channel cats. We started out with a shallow water pattern that's been producing a few blues. They boated several nice fish from this spot including Marcy's big fish of the day! The sandbass moved in and our baits didn't stand a chance. Moved out to some deeper water and set up on the end of a deeper point covering water that's 20-25 feet deep and marking quite a few fish. Eddie quickly hooked up with a nice box fish before I had 4 rods in the water. They caught several more nice blues before reaching the half-way mark in the trip.

We then switched over to my channel cat gear and broke out the dip bait and punch bait. Had to keep moving to stay on the fish and never really found the good concentration of active channel cats we were looking for. 2-1/2 hours isn't a very long time to target and locate each species before moving on to the next. Final count was a mix of 30 blues and channel cats along with 4 deep-hooked sandbass. The fish today were caught on fresh shad with Dead Red Blood Spray and Secret 7 dip bait and Sudden Impact catfish bait.

Lake Lewisville Catfish Guide Report - 6/13/11

I took our daughter Abby out for her first fishing trip of her summer vacation. She got off to a quick starting landing a small bass from the boat ramp before I was was even able to get the boat in the water. We hit a couple of areas and caught between 40 and 50 sandbass and small hybrids while schooling on top. We caught all of those on Mice lures from "No Geese". Abby lost her pink one and set me on a mission to get her a replacement. Next up was to scout some areas out for channel some cats. Hit some areas with brush, rocks, stumps, grass and deeper ledges between 2 and 20 feet deep. All produced fish. We had 47 on the clicker in about 4 hours keeping 12 deep-hooked fish for the freezer. Fish were caught using Secret 7 dip bait and Sudden Impact from Team Catfish on both corks and Carolina rigs. Lots of fun and great times with my princess! Yes the pink is just for her.

Lake Lewisville Fishing Guide Report - 6/17/11

Star, Karen and Greg joined me Friday morning for a half-day channel cat trip on Lewisville. The winds were tough and limited the areas we could fish. We got out of the rough stuff, but the winds still put it to us. Got the anchors set, a few lines out and the BIG box anchor started to slide! Made a short move and tied up to something a bit more solid and steadily started putting some fish in the box and throwing back even more undersized fish. Set up several more times with each spot only producing a few fish. It was a hard 5 hours of fishing and only had 23 keepers to show for our effort. The bite was really light and difficult to detect in the wind at times. All fish were caught on Secret 7 and Sudden Impact from Team Catfish. Fish were caught on both Carolina rigs and corks 2 to 20 feet deep. Still have plenty of dates open for summer channel cat or blue cat trips on either Lewisville or Grapevine.

Lake Lewisville Fishing Report - 6/23/11

Repeat customers Chris Sr. and his son Chris Jr. came out to fish with me for a third time Thursday morning. We started off hitting the channel cats. The bite was really good, but way too many undersized fish. Had some sandbass come up on top for a few minutes and decided to give that a try. After catching several smaller sandies the schools dissapeared. Next on the agenda was to target some summer time blues. We located some fish and busted up bait on the fish finder. Got set up, baited rods in the water and the catching soon began. The guys kept up a steady pace for the remainder of the trip filling the box with eating size blues in the 1-9 lb range. They finished up with a mix of 36 blues and channel cats. The channel cats were caught on Secret 7 dip bait and Sudden Impact Catfish Bait from Team Catfish. The blues were caught using fresh shad with Dead Red Blood Spray. Here are a couple of pics from Thursday's trip.

Lake Lewisville Fishing Guide Report - 6/24/11

Tom and Ben joined me for a 5-hour blue cat trip on Lake Lewisville. Couldn't ask for a more beautiful morning on the lake. The winds were calm and not much boat traffic either. I made bait in two throws of the Bait Buster, watched a gorgeous sunrise, picked the guys up at the dock and headed out to see what the day would bring. We got set up right where we left them biting the day before. The blues were still there and willing to bite. The guys quickly picked up on fishing with circle hooks and hardly missed any fish. We hit the 5 hour mark and headed back to the dock with some nice fish in the box. Ben had big fish honors with a 7 lb blue, and Tom insisted on taking home the most fish award for the day. Final count was 44 blue cats all receiving an invitation to a neighborhood fish fry. All fish were caught using fresh shad with Dead Red Blood Spray.
